Which is a remnant of an old system never implemented. A regular Legendary with Max Roll Might Aspect is exactly the same as Ancestral Legendary with Max Roll Might Aspect.
The only Aspects that scale with iLvl are the ones with X values. If you want the highest roll, it has to come from a 925 item.
The only things that should be level locked qre the Aspects with X values to prevent Twinks from running with say, Burning Rage, dealing a ridiculous amount of damage early on.
